UN General Assembly 2025 Kicks Off Amid Global Focus
Source: Israel (2025-09-26)
The United Nations General Assembly has begun its 2025 session, bringing together representatives from around the world to discuss pressing international issues. The event features a multilingual platform, including Arabic, Chinese, English, French, Russian, and Spanish, emphasizing global inclusivity. Delegates are set to engage in debates on key topics affecting global stability and development. The assembly aims to foster dialogue and cooperation among nations to address shared challenges and promote peace worldwide.
